<description>&#60;p&#62;@78h2o: We had a lawyer do a full estate plan for us (wills, establishing a trust for LO, living wills, financial power of attorney and health care power of attorney) and it was $1,000 for  the whole package.  We also didn't want to pick grandparents because of their age.  We named my brother (and by default his wife) as guardian and my husband's sister as the secondary in case something happens to my brother as well.  I was not comfortable with my SIL being first choice because like your SIL she is not married.  She has a boyfriend whom we expect her to marry but it's not a done deal yet.  And whoever becomes her husband would essentially be acting as my child's father and until we know who that person is I wasn't comfortable making her our first choice.  We love my brother and SIL, they are due with their first baby this year so we know there will be other children in the house, they would raise M very similar to how we would, and while we have life insurance and assets that will be there for M, we also know that my bro and SIL are more than financially capable of taking her on and that definitely played a part in our decision making.
